Transaction 589f4380dcfe510bcf9e19fc05e012143c80cc317a90d2b0b9316580a0e1c0ef

block
91a5915cb4d08f62f7430b64a236dbf40efa3f3524903720d17a852755ed1278

1 Input

2 Outputs